Latest Patents
Yochai Edlitz's latest patents include a "Method and apparatus for curing ink" and a "Method and apparatus for curing ink on a substrate." Both patents describe an apparatus designed to cure ink effectively on a substrate. The apparatus features a substrate support and a curing sheet that creates a gap between the substrate and the sheet. Additionally, it includes an oxygen-depletion mechanism to reduce oxygen levels in the gap, along with an ultra-violet (UV) radiation source that applies UV radiation through the curing sheet to the substrate. This innovative design enhances the curing process, ensuring better quality and efficiency in printing.
